Definition
  1. Noun:
    • A species of freshwater fish: "Ambloplites rupestris" is the scientific name for a specific type of game and food fish, commonly known as the rock bass. It is native to freshwater habitats in eastern North America.
Usage
  • The word "Ambloplites rupestris" is used in formal, scientific, or technical contexts such as biology, ichthyology (the study of fish), ecology, and fishing regulations. It is not typically used in everyday conversation, where the common name "rock bass" is preferred.

Variants and Related Words
  • Rock bass (n): The universally accepted common name for .
    • We caught several rock bass near the dock.
  • Goggle-eye (n): A regional common name for this fish in some parts of the United States.
  • Redeye (n): Another informal name sometimes used, though it can refer to other species.
Synonyms
  • Rock bass: The primary synonym used in non-scientific contexts.
  • Rock sunfish: A less common alternative name that references its family (Centrarchidae, the sunfishes).
